The Audi A6 Avant 2.7 TDI quattro Pro Line is a wagon powered by a diesel engine delivering 180 hp (132 kW). It acc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 9.1 s and reaches a top speed of 223 km/h. Fuel efficiency stands at 8.5 l/100 km combined, CO₂ emissions of 222 g/km. Drive is routed to the all-wheel-drive axle via an automatic. This variant was introduced in 2005 as part of the Audi A6 Avant (2005-2008) generation, and sits alongside 3 other variants in this generation.
